This is a cubic (odd degree) function with a positive leading coefficient, so it will be increasing until the first turning point, and after the last turning point. It will be decreasing between the turning points.
a) A graph shows the zeros to be x = -1, x = 3, x = 4.
b) A graph shows the local maximum to be approximately (0.472, 13.128). The x-coordinate of this point is exactly 2-√(7/3).
c) The local minimum is about (3.528, -1.128). Its x-coordinate is exactly 2+√(7/3).
d) As stated above, the increasing intervals are (-∞, 0.428) ∪ (3.528, ∞).
e) The decreasing interval is (0.428, 3.528).
_____
Additional comments
The sum of odd-degree term coefficients is the same as the sum of coefficients of even-degree terms, so you know one of the roots is -1. Factoring that out gives the quadratic x^2 -7x +12 = (x -3)(x -4), so the other two roots are 3 and 4.
The derivative is 3x^2 -12x +5 = 3(x -2)^2 -7, so its roots (turning points of f(x)) are 2±√(7/3).

If the company were to issue an annual zero-coupon bond with a maturity of 2 years and a par value of $1,000, what would be the arbitrage-free price of that bond?
Answer:
Step-by-step explanation:
[tex]\text{here is the missing text:} \\ \\ \text{ Suppose a company issues an annual coupon bond with a maturity of 2 years,} \\ \\ \text{ price of $950 \ par \ value \ of $1,000, and coupon rate of 5\% They also issue an}[/tex]
[tex]\text{ annual zero-coupon bond with a maturity of 1 year, price of $900, \ and \ par \ value \ of \ $1,000.}[/tex]
[tex]\text{To determine the 1-year spot rate using the 1-year zero bond.} \\ \\ FV = PV \times (1 + S_1) \\ \\ 1+ S_1 = \dfrac{FV}{PV} \\ \\ 1 + S_1 = \dfrac{1000}{900} \\ \\ S_1 = 11.11\%[/tex]
[tex]\text{PV of the 2-year bond = 950} \\ \\ Annual coupon = 1000 \times 5\% = \$50 \\ \\ \\ 950 = \dfrac{50}{(1+S_1) }+ \dfrac{(50+1000)}{(1+S_2)^2} \\ \\ 950 = \dfrac{50}{1.1111}+ \dfrac{1050}{(1+S_2)^2} \\ \\ \dfrac{1050}{(1+S_2)^2}=950 -45\\ \\ \dfrac{1050}{(1+S_2)^2}=905 \\ \\ (1+S_2)^2 = \dfrac{1050}{905} \\ \\ 1 + S_2= \sqrt{(1.16022)} \\ \\ S_2 = 7.714\%[/tex]
[tex]\text{the arbitrage-free price of the 2-year bond}= \dfrac{1000}{(1+0.07714)^2} \\ \\ = \mathbf{\$861.90}[/tex]

Answer:
58
Step-by-step explanation:
The angles inside a triangle always sum to 180°. We already have a 32° angle and a 90° - totalling 122° - and when we add x°, we'd like the sum to be 180°. So x must be 180 - 122 = 58.
